In the UK, the median waiting time for prostatectomy is forecasted to remain stable from 2024 to 2027 at 58 days, reflecting zero percent year-on-year change, before experiencing a slight increase to 59 days in 2028. Compared to waiting times in 2023, the stability indicates a consistent pressure on healthcare resources.
Future trends to watch:
- Potential impact of policy changes aimed at reducing hospital wait times.
- Influence of technological advancements and efficiencies in surgical procedures.
- Effects of demographic shifts, particularly an aging population, which may increase demand for prostatectomies.
